Our Arctic Neighbors: Tanker collision tests Russian readiness

Government, oil company happy with results of rescue, cleanup exercises at newly opened Varandey terminal in Barents Sea

Sarah Hurst

For Petroleum News

The Varandey oil export terminal in the Barents Sea, which began working in June, hosted international training exercises for tanker and oil spill management Oct. 1, according to operator Lukoil.
